SB175 Summary
-
Transfers all law enforcement functions of conservation officers from the Wildlife and Freshwater Fisheries Division of the Department of Conservation and Natural Resources to a newly created Conservation Enforcement Division within the Alabama State Law Enforcement Agency.
-
Creates the Conservation Enforcement Division within the Department of Public Safety, with the director appointing a chief of the division (except for conservation officer appointments, which remain under Section 9-11-17).
-
Requires agencies controlling restricted funds (due to state or federal requirements) to reimburse the Alabama State Law Enforcement Agency for administration, manpower, benefits, equipment, and other expenses used to perform authorized tasks.
-
Makes the Alabama State Law Enforcement Agency a service provider for agencies with restricted funds, allowing use of their equipment within applicable funding restrictions and requiring proper accounting of purpose-restricted monies.
-
Effective date: January 1, 2015.
